Disruption of the Wnt-antagonist <i>Apc</i> in the pituitary stem cells drives the development of adamantinomatous craniopharyngioma
2025-09-29
Abstract excerpt
Adamantinomatous craniopharyngiomas (aCPs) are complex intracranial neoplasms that generally arise in the sellar and suprasellar region of the brain which affect the endocrine and nervous systems causing severe sequelae.
